I'm a big fan of Ivy Smoak's The Hunted Series, so I was excited to see one of her new titles as an ARC on NetGalley. "Bad Things Feel Best" was not at all what I expected, but I don't mean that in a negative way. From the very beginning, Smoak does a fantastic job creating a spooky, ominous mood. Hazel Fox arrives at famous author Athena Quinn's beautiful mansion optimistic about her new job and hopefully gaining a mentor. Things quickly start to feel "not right," making Hazel question not only her decision to take the job but her own instincts as well.

The other main character, Mr. Remington, is a conundrum. As a male lead, he wasn't at all likeable, but I feel that this was 100% the author's intent with this character. I found myself coming to the same conclusion as Hazel about why Mr. Remington behaved the way he did, but also like Hazel kept second guessing what I was seeing.

Overall, this book deviated from what I normally read in a lot of good ways. The setting was masterfully created and the female lead was likeable. However, some of the storyline was farfetched, and I felt that the ending left me questioning so many things that it felt unfinished. If you're a reader that is okay living with some ambiguity, though, this shouldn't bother you at all. All in all, even with my thoughts about the ending, I don't regret picking up this book.

This book suffered from an identity crisis. The author had us going in one direction with a creepy kind of mystery while also developing a romantic storyline. Neither was successful.

Hazel Fox accepts a job as a famous writer's assistant, but when she arrives it turns out that she is the assistant to the writer's assistant. Her workplace is a gigantic house on the beach. From the beginning something seems off. The assistant insists she call him Mr. Remington, not wear shoes to dinner and tells her that she most likely won't ever meet the author she is supposed to be working for.

Hazel's imagination goes into overdrive and all of the clues indicate that Mr. Remington could be some kind of monster, yet she cannot help but be attracted to him. Smoak does a great job with the creepy storyline and I was kind of hoping the plot would go in the direction of a modern day Beauty and the Beast. It doesn't. The author isn't successful in making the relationship that develops between Mr. Remington and Hazel very believable. Mr. Remington's character isn't developed enough and his interactions with Hazel are mostly odd, so by the time they get together the relationship doesn't feel fully realized.

This book is really short and I think it would have benefitted by adding some meat to the bones - round out the characters, have the relationship go through some different ups and downs.

This book follows Hazel who accepts a new job working for famous novelist Athena Quinn. As she arrives to Ms. Quinn’s estate she is met with a surprise, she has actually been hired to be assistant to Mr. Remington (who is already Athena Quinn’s assistant). Mysterious and creepy things happen throughout the estate and Hazel tries to get to the bottom of it.

I really loved the imagery in this book but a lot of the other aspects fell short for me. There were so many questions left unanswered and loose ends. The romance aspect was hard for me to believe and I wanted so badly to root for them and love them but I just never did.

And the ending fell flat for me too! The two major “plot twists” were obvious. I have loved some of Ivy’s other books so I’m sad I didn’t love this one. Just not for me.
